How they compare

Namibia currently reports 24,193 metric tons against 12,976 metric tons in Guinea-Bissau, a difference of 11,217 metric tons.

That makes Namibia's figure about 1.9 times Guinea-Bissau's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 51 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Namibia ahead.

Guinea-Bissau ranks 28th and Namibia ranks 26th of 37 countries.

Namibia has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Guinea-Bissau Namibia Difference Ahead
1960s 6,467 metric tons 18,133 metric tons 11,666 metric tons Namibia
1970s 6,700 metric tons 29,300 metric tons 22,600 metric tons Namibia
1980s 17,545 metric tons 44,100 metric tons 26,555 metric tons Namibia
1990s 23,256 metric tons 52,010 metric tons 28,754 metric tons Namibia
2000s 29,470 metric tons 54,867 metric tons 25,397 metric tons Namibia
2010s 13,990 metric tons 32,096 metric tons 18,106 metric tons Namibia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
